关于微前端是什么,以及微前端落地方案,社区遍地都是,本篇文章不会再赘述这些基础知识。当然如果你没了解过上述知识,也可以直接读下这篇文章,足够浅显易懂。这篇文章通过实现一个商城后台,介绍了基于 umi 框架的微前端落地方案,通过这篇文章,你可以收获超级简单的、可用于生产环境的基于 umi 的微前端实践,包括一套示例代码全新的、基于微前端的大型台项目前端组织方式一些技术栈umi[1] 插件化的企业级
一、前端高可用架构设计用户请求——>DNS域名解析(轮询)——>Nginx虚拟ip(keepalived监测心跳)——>tomcat服务 DNS轮训缺点: a.只负责IP轮询获取,不保证节点可用 b.DNS IP列表变更有延时 c.外网IP占用严重二、后端高并发架构图一、千万级用户量压力预估预估客户数量1000万,根据28法则活跃用户200万,假设平均每个用户有30次点击,共计6
转载 2023-08-21 09:44:50
539阅读
在分布式、微服务盛行的今天,绝大部分项目都采用的微服务框架,前后端分离方式。题外话:前后端的工作职责越来越明确,现在的前端都称之为大前端技术栈以及生态圈都已经非常成熟;以前后端人员瞧不起前端人员,那现在后端人员要重新认识一下前端前端已经很成体系了。一般系统的大致整体架构图如下:在这里插入图片描述需要说明的是,有些小伙伴会回复说,这个架构太简单了吧,太low了,什么网关啊,缓存啊,消息中间件啊,
前端工具和环境:Node.js V10.15.0Vue.js V2.5.21yarn: V1.13.0IDE:VScode后端工具和环境:Maven: 3.52jdk: 1.8MySql: 14.14IDE: IDEASpring Boot: 2.0+Zookeeper:3.4.13前后端分离(服务端渲染、浏览器渲染)实现真正的前后端解耦。核心思想是前端html页面通过ajax调用后
需要说明的是,有些小伙伴会回复说,这个架构太简单了吧,太low了,什么网关啊,缓存啊,消息中间件啊,都没有。因为老顾这篇主要介绍的是API接口,所以我们聚焦点,其他的模块小伙伴们自行去补充。接口交互前端后端进行交互,前端按照约定请求URL路径,并传入相关参数,后端服务器接收请求,进行业务处理,返回数据给前端。针对URL路径的restful风格,以及传入参数的公共请求头的要求(如:app_vers
# 前端后端架构图的实现指南 在现代应用程序的开发前端后端架构图是非常重要的一部分。它可以帮助我们理解应用程序各个组件之间的关系和交互。在这篇文章,我会指导你如何实现一个完整的前端后端架构图。我们将从流程开始,逐步深入到每一个细节。 ## 流程步骤 以下是我们实现前端后端架构图的基本流程: | 步骤 | 描述 | | --- | --- | | 1 | 确定系统的主要功能模块 |
原创 8月前
21阅读
今天就带着学习的态度和大家分享后端这些看似可以装逼可以飞的带逼格的关键词吧。分布式在学校里的项目中,一个 Web 系统可能咋们一个人就搞定,因为几乎不考虑并发量,性能咋样,所谓「过得去 」足矣,但是为了面试考虑,我们又不得不找点类似秒杀系统作为我们简历的支撑项目(即使已经烂大街)。那么先问你第一个问题,为什么就采用了分布式的方案落地这个项目?当一个人或者几十个使用你的系统,哎呀我去,请求秒回,效果
# 实现系统前端后端技术架构图前端展示层 在当今的软件开发,清晰的前端后端架构图是确保系统各个部分有效协同的重要工具。本文将详细介绍如何展示系统的前端后端技术架构图,特别是前端展示层的实现。以下是整个过程的步骤和细节。 ## 整体流程 以下表格展示了实现前端展示层系统架构图的主要步骤: | 步骤 | 描述 | |------|---------
原创 2024-10-18 06:05:50
197阅读
# 前端台后端架构设计 ## 引言 前端台和后端架构是现代应用开发的重要组成部分。前端台负责展示和交互,后端架构则负责处理数据和业务逻辑。本文将介绍前端台后端架构的设计原则和示例代码,帮助读者理解和应用这些概念。 ## 什么是前端台后端架构 前端台后端架构是一种将前端后端分离的软件开发模式。它的核心思想是将前端后端功能模块化,解耦合,使得系统更容易开发和维护。 在这种架构
原创 2024-01-03 12:31:42
136阅读
前端 nginx 后端架构图是现代 web 开发不可或缺的一部分,它使得服务器能高效地管理前端请求和后端数据交互。这个架构通常包含多个组件,比如 nginx 作为反向代理、负载均衡器,以及后端的一系列服务。接下来,我们将深入探讨其背景、技术原理、架构解析、源码分析、应用场景以及扩展讨论,为你提供一个全面的理解。 ### 背景描述 在当今高度互联的世界前端后端的分离架构设计正在成为主流。
原创 6月前
63阅读
# 前端后端连接架构图实战指南 作为一名刚入行的开发者,理解前端后端的连接是非常重要的。本文将为你详细讲解如何实现前端后端的连接架构图。我们将用表格展示整个流程,并提供每一步的代码示例以及详细注释,确保你对每一步都有深入的了解。 ## 流程步骤 以下是实现前端后端连接的基本流程步骤: | 步骤 | 描述
原创 11月前
232阅读
从去年做空间开始,这一年来,一直在提前端后端这样两个概念,同时,也在小组内推行着技术上的分工,并在开发模式上尝试着创新。在学习了Spring、IBatis之后,对于前端后分工的需求也越来越强烈,所以,岗位的分工也根据开发的分工而开始尝试。    在我们实际的开发过程,我们当前这样定位前端后端开发人员。    1)前端开发人员:精通JS,能熟练应用JQ
Nodejs后端实现微信小程序支付一、前言二、微信小程序支付流程三、工具类四、微信支付统一下单接口解析五、小程序调用微信支付六、总结 一、前言前端时间在做微信小程序后端的时候,小程序中用到了微信支付的功能,后端需要接入微信支付的接口,实现小程序的支付功能。第一次接触支付相关的内容,在此写篇文章记录一下。二、微信小程序支付流程首先引用微信官方的小程序支付流程图:【微信官方支付API文档】 微信官方
刚来这家公司的时候,我对于台的理解仅限博客,知乎,百度。没有台的时代在传统IT企业,项目的物理结构是什么样的呢?无论项目内部的如何复杂,都可分为“前台”和“后台”这两部分。 什么是前台?首先,这里所说的“前台”和“前端”并不是一回事。所谓前台即包括各种和用户直接交互的界面,比如web页面,手机app;也包括服务端各种实时响应用户请求的业务逻辑,比如商品查询、物流查询、订单系统、评价
# 前后端技术架构详解 随着互联网技术的迅猛发展,前后端分离的技术架构逐渐成为了现代Web应用开发的重要趋势。前后端架构可以提高团队协作效率、增强系统的可维护性和可扩展性。本文将围绕前后端架构的基本概念、组件、工作流程进行详解,同时给出相关的代码示例,帮助读者更好地理解这一技术架构。 ## 前后端分离架构 在传统的Web开发前端后端通常是紧密结合的,即前端的展示逻辑和后端的业务逻辑在同
原创 2024-10-30 04:05:46
73阅读
摘要:本篇文章是由于笔者喜欢看各类博客来学习知识,但是由于CSDN复制黏贴的文章过多,以及每次看完的知识点都很难找到,所以想把好的一些文章进行汇总以便日后再次进行查看!!!数据库深入理解SQL的四种连接-左外连接、右外连接、内连接、全连接传送门SQL的子查询的使用传送门MySQL主从复制原理传送门JavaJava泛型传送门内存泄漏传送门JVM 方法区、永久代、元空间、常量池详解传送门区别 方法区
转载 2024-08-19 16:41:03
55阅读
由于J-LINK贵且公司涉及到版权问题,所以想自制一个J-LINK。在网上下载了一个demo代码,但是编译过程出现几个问题,现在总结。 连接如下: github: https://github.com/RadioOperator/STM32F103C8T6_CMSIS-DAP_SWO一、在网上下载的demo,点击keil工程入口,弹出如下图:这个弹框意思是,工程是用UV4建的,现在用UV5打开了,
# 前端技术架构概述 随着互联网的发展,前端技术日新月异。为了开发高效的网页和应用,理解前端技术架构显得尤为重要。本文将通过一个简单的前端技术架构图,帮助你了解前端的各个组成部分,并提供一些代码示例,以便更好地理解这些技术是如何协同工作的。 ## 前端技术架构图 前端技术架构可以分为几个主要部分: - **HTML (超文本标记语言)** - **CSS (层叠样式表)** - **Jav
原创 9月前
98阅读
# 微前端技术架构图:解析与实现 在现代web开发,微前端(Micro-Frontend)是一种逐渐流行的方法论,旨在将大型前端应用分解为多个较小、独立的部分。这种架构不仅提高了团队协作能力,还能够提升代码的可维护性和可扩展性。本文将详细介绍微前端技术架构,并提供实际的代码示例来帮助理解。 ## 微前端的核心概念 微前端理念源于微服务架构,其主要思想是将一个庞大的前端应用拆分为多个独立的
原创 11月前
186阅读
前端前端开发是创建Web页面或app等前端界面呈现给用户的过程,通过HTML,CSS及JavaScript以及衍生出来的各种技术、框架、解决方案,来实现互联网产品的用户界面交互 。它从网页制作演变而来,名称上有很明显的时代特征。在互联网的演化进程,网页制作是Web1.0时代的产物,早期网站主要内容都是静态,以图片和文字为主,用户使用网站的行为也以浏览为主。随着互联网技术的发展和HTML5、CSS
转载 2024-07-16 10:09:18
107阅读
  • 1
  • 2
  • 3
  • 4
  • 5